The dreaded "no response" email!

Don't worry, it's a common phenomenon, and there are several reasons why someone might not respond to your email. Here are a few possible explanations:

  1. Overwhelmed inbox: The person might be dealing with a massive amount of emails and hasn't had a chance to get to yours yet.
  2. Busy schedule: They might be extremely busy with work, personal, or family commitments and haven't had time to respond.
  3. Unimportant or irrelevant email: They might not consider your email a priority or relevant to their current tasks.
  4. Technical issues: There could be technical problems with their email account, such as a full inbox or a faulty email client.
  5. Lack of interest: Unfortunately, they might not be interested in responding to your email or engaging with you.

What can you do?

  1. Wait a reasonable amount of time: Give the person a few days to respond before sending a follow-up email.
  2. Send a polite follow-up email: If you haven't received a response, you can send a brief follow-up email to check if they received your initial message.
  3. Rephrase or reformat your email: If you're sending a long email, try breaking it up into smaller, more concise messages.
  4. Use a different communication channel: If you're trying to reach someone via email, consider using a different channel, such as phone or social media.
  5. Don't take it personally: Remember that not responding to an email doesn't necessarily mean the person is ignoring you or doesn't value your message.

Remember to stay calm, patient, and professional when dealing with non-responsive emails. Good luck!
